抓包工具是网络安全和开发调试过程中不可或缺的助手。它们可以有效地捕获和分析网络数据包的传输情况,无论是HTTP请求响应,还是其他协议的数据交互,抓包工具都能提供详细的信息。这对于开发者来说,可以帮助识别和解决应用程序中的问题;而对于网络安全人员,抓包工具则是检测潜在安全威胁的重要手段。选择合适的抓包工具既可以提升工作效率,也能确保网络数据的安全性和稳定性。

面对市场上琳琅满目的抓包工具,如何挑选适合自己的工具呢?需要明确使用目的。如果是进行简单的网页调试,像Fiddler或Charles这样的工具就非常合适,因为它们界面友好,功能全面,特别适合Web开发。而如果涉及到复杂的协议分析或需要更强的自定义功能,可以考虑Wireshark。Wireshark是一个功能强大的网络协议分析工具,能够捕获并深入分析各种型号的数据包,适用于网络安全人员和高级开发者。
用户体验也是选择抓包工具时的重要考量因素。有些工具可能功能强大,但学习曲线陡峭,普通用户难以上手。抓包工具如Postman,不仅支持抓包功能,其直观的用户界面和强大的API测试功能,使得开发和测试工作变得更加高效。一些工具还拥有丰富的社区支持和教程,可以帮助新手快速掌握工具的使用方法和技巧。
抓包工具的兼容性和性能也是不可忽视的方面。确保所选工具能够与使用的操作系统和开发环境兼容,能够顺利运行并处理高并发的数据流。如果使用在合适的平台下,工具的性能也会更加出色。选择合适的抓包工具不仅可以提升工作效率,还可以帮助用户更好地理解网络数据,从而做出更为精准的决策。通过对需求的仔细分析,以及对市场上众多工具的对比,用户定能找到最适合自己的抓包方案。
